WASHINGTON, IL -- The Heartland Festival Orchestra's April 15 concert at Five Points Washington was an interesting change of pace for the orchestra.
The youthful New York City trio Empire Wild played with the orchestra in most of the program, presenting an original fusion of classical and jazz with rich sound.
Empire Wild was fine, and included a singer, some original pieces and arrangements, and even a bit of audience participation, hand clapping.
And the Illinois Central College Concert Choir presented "The Ecstasy of Gold" a choral piece from the film The Good, the Bad and the Ugly. The director, Julie Clemens, with a fabulous voice, was the soloist.
It was a lovely evening.
